30 new & expanded coal mines in Queensland!? Time to change direction.

Late last year the Queensland Government released a draft of their plan for the resources sector over the next 30 years, the Queensland Resources Industry Development Plan (QRIDP), and now they are seeking your input before they finalise it. 

Submissions are due this Friday 11th February

The Plan proposes a couple of positive initiatives, but they don’t get far enough, and they’ve done nothing to protect our most precious areas from coal and gas - cultural sites, farmland and environmental icons are all at risk.

For the first time, the Qld Government has committed to reporting and monitoring direct and indirect emissions from mining and gas mines.  That’s a big and important step - but they need to do it properly, using strict caps and limits on emissions.

They also have no plan to support communities to diversify as global trading partners shift away from fossil fuels to renewables and coal mining inevitably dwindles.
